SCIS Group launches recruitment drive to boost Devon’s energy efficiency sector

SCIS Group, a leading provider of energy efficiency services, has announced the launch of an extensive recruitment campaign aimed at bolstering its workforce to support the delivery of its expanding operations, particularly in Devon.

With a vision to become to UK’s largest energy-efficiency installer, SCIS Group is actively seeking talented individuals to join its team and contribute to the growth of the energy efficiency sector in Devon and beyond.

The company’s recruitment drive in Devon is part of its broader initiative to triple its existing leadership and operative positions, encompassing roles such as insulation supervisors, technical monitoring inspectors, and administrator managers.

In Devon, SCIS Group is looking to hire 26 installers (renewable engineers/technicians/insulation installers) to form 13 teams, further enhancing its presence and capacity to deliver energy efficiency solutions in Devon.

SCIS Group is actively working with energy suppliers from the Big 6 and has secured multimillion-pound funding for thousands of homes across Devon and nationwide eligible for energy efficiency improvements under the Great British Insulation Scheme.

Homes in Devon also stand to benefit from the government’s Energy Company Obligation (ECO4), an energy efficiency scheme designed to provide grants to fund energy-efficient upgrades. These upgrades not only reduce carbon emissions but also help lower electricity consumption and energy bills for Devon residents.

The recruitment drive offers individuals a chance to join a dynamic and fast-growing organisation with ample opportunities for career advancement and development. SCIS Group provides comprehensive training and development programmes, including qualifications in ACOPS and NVQ Level 3 in cavity wall insulation. Employees also enjoy a range of benefits, including comprehensive remuneration packages and bonuses, a company pension scheme, life insurance, and opportunities for career progression and development within a rapidly expanding organisation.

Nic Gillanders, CEO, SCIS Group, comments: “We are excited to launch this recruitment drive as part of our growth strategy in Devon. By investing in talent and expertise, we can play a significant role in advancing energy efficiency initiatives and helping to create a more sustainable future for Devon and its residents.

“We expect 2024 to be a record year for SCIS Group in Devon, with better-developed funded schemes and a focus on new customer segments, including customers who will privately finance their home energy efficiency improvements.”

SCIS is also interested in exploring partnership opportunities with Trustmark-accredited companies in Devon to fulfil its projected install forecasts and further contribute to the region’s energy efficiency goals.
